Tammie R. Gunn, 61, of Grand Island, passed away Wednesday, Feb. 3, 2022, at CHI Health Bergan Mercy in Omaha. Visitation will be 5-7 p.m. Monday, Feb. 14, at All Faiths Funeral Home. Services in her honor will be 1 p.m. Tuesday, Feb. 15, at All Faiths Funeral Home. Elder Jeff Hayman will officiate. Burial will follow at Westlawn Memorial Park Cemetery. All Faiths Funeral Home is entrusted arrangements. Tammie was born Sept. 5, 1960, in Hagerstown, Md., the daughter of Leonard and Bonnie (Brewer) Carney. She moved several times growing up, but found her home in Grand Island and graduated with the class of 1979. Later that year she married Russell Gunn on June 30, 1979. She was happy to put roots down in Grand Island and raise their three sons here. She was employed in security with Fonner Park for 20 years. After retirement, she worked at JoAnn Fabrics. Tammie was a member of Church of Jesus Christ of Latter Day Saints in Grand Island. Tammie enjoyed collecting bears and snowmen, and all sorts of crafts. Through her work in genealogy, Tammie was able to track her family clear back to the Vikings, along with many other interesting facts. Her world was her family and friends who became family. She loved every minute she could spend with her grandkids and enjoyed her sons' humor and conversation. Her legacy is continued by her sons, Chris Gunn and Michael (Amber Betterly) Gunn, both of Grand Island; three grandchildren, Elizabeth, Jessee and Russel E. Gunn II; four brothers and numerous extended family and friends. She is preceded in death by her husband, Russell Eugene Gunn; son, Russell Edwin Gunn II.
